IT Tactical Plan

The MSJC Information Technology Tactical Plan for 2011-2012 will serve as the roadmap for resource allocation for the Information Technology Department during the 2011-2012 academic year. Utilizing MSJC’s integrated planning model, this Tactical Plan draws inputs from MSJC’s 2011-2014 Strategic Plan, MSJC’s 2011-2016 Technology Master Plan, and Information Technology’s Program Review in order to determine district priorities and allocate resources for the MSJC Information Technology department. Additionally, in the 2011-2012 Information Technology Tactical Plan, considerations are made for the staff, financial, and system resources required for the sustainability of currently supported systems and processes. The 2011-2012 Information Technology Tactical Plan is an aggressive one year plan that shall be challenging to implement. Staff, financial, and physical resources will be allocated toward identified initiatives based on prioritization, availability of implementation resources, and availability of sustainability resources. The sixty-one (61) projects contained within the 2011-2012 Information Technology Tactical Plan does estimate an over-allocation of approximately 1,400 staff hours towards project implementation. Information Technology will seek to implement internal and external initiatives in order streamline processes and eliminate redundant staff processing in order to mitigate a portion of this over-allocation.
